Buncombe, IL vs Nelson, IL
The cost of living difference between Buncombe, IL and Nelson, IL is dramatic. Nelson is 71% cheaper than Buncombe,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Buncombe has a cost index of 99 while Nelson sits at 58,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.
Median household income in Buncombe is $62,500 compared to $45,938 in Nelson (+36.1%). The higher salaries in Buncombe partially offset the cost difference, but don't fully close the gap.
